Too new for a strong community consensus yet. Early reviews mention a fresh and spicy profile with prominent bergamot and mint at the top, followed by a warm heart of black tea and ginger. Some users appreciate the balance of freshness and warmth, while others find it lacks depth or longevity. The fragrance is often described as suitable for casual wear and warmer seasons, but opinions vary on its overall appeal and performance.
